New NYS Requirement: Critical Patch 6 is now required for all ePCR submissions
Attention All Agencies: NYS has announced that NEMSIS Critical Patch 6 is now required for all ePCR submissions. Agencies utilizing either the Central Elite ImageTrend or any of the NYS ImageTrend Ambulance, ALSFR, or BLSFR Portals, no action is needed at this time. Agencies using their own software vendors (emsCharts, iPCR, Cloud, ESO, etc.) should contact your software vendors and ensure they have implemented this update into your systems to avoid any disruption to your ePC
